NVIDIA Corporation Stock: Dominating AI Chip Markets with Record Growth and Strategic Innovation in 2026
26.03.2026 - 18:32:25 | ad-hoc-news.deNVIDIA Corporation stands at the forefront of the artificial intelligence revolution, powering the global shift toward AI-driven computing. Its latest Q4 FY2026 results showcase explosive growth, with revenue reaching $68.13 billion, a 73% increase year-over-year, primarily fueled by Data Center revenue of $62.31 billion, up 75%. This performance underscores NVIDIA's pivotal role in enabling hyperscalers and enterprises to deploy advanced AI models at scale.

Visit official websiteNVIDIA Corporation designs and manufactures graphics processing units (GPUs) optimized for AI, gaming, and professional visualization. The company's shift from gaming-focused graphics cards to AI accelerators has redefined its market position. Key products like the Hopper and Blackwell architectures dominate high-performance computing workloads.
Data Center remains NVIDIA's growth engine, contributing the majority of revenue through AI training and inference chips. In Q4 FY2026, Data Center Networking surged 263% to $10.98 billion, driven by Blackwell deployments and NVLink interconnects. This segment benefits from diversified demand across cloud providers and enterprise AI adopters.
NVIDIA's CUDA software platform creates a moat, locking in developers with optimized tools for parallel computing. This ecosystem advantage ensures sustained demand for its hardware, as switching costs for AI workloads are prohibitively high.

For fiscal year 2026, NVIDIA reported $215.9 billion in revenue, up 65% from the prior year, with gross margins near 75% non-GAAP. Free cash flow exceeded $90 billion, supporting R&D investments and share repurchases. These metrics highlight NVIDIA's ability to convert AI demand into profitable growth.
The stock has delivered remarkable returns: 60% over one year, 1,400% over five years, and 20,000% over ten years as of March 2026. Post its 10-for-1 split in 2024, shares continue to outperform the PHLX Semiconductor Index, reflecting consistent execution.
Trading at a forward P/E of about 23x, NVIDIA appears reasonably valued given projected 60%+ earnings growth. Annual free cash flow of $96.58 billion bolsters its 22x forward multiple. Investors value this cash generation amid hyperscaler expansions.
Strategic Innovations Driving Growth
NVIDIA's Blackwell platform represents the latest leap in AI silicon, enabling trillion-parameter models for inference at scale. Deployments with major cloud providers accelerate revenue from networking and systems integration. This positions NVIDIA as the foundational layer for the "Age of Inference."
Beyond chips, NVIDIA offers full-stack solutions including DGX systems and Omniverse for digital twins. These integrated offerings command premium pricing and expand total addressable market. Enterprise adoption in automotive, healthcare, and robotics further diversifies revenue streams.
R&D spending fuels continuous innovation, with next-generation architectures in development. NVIDIA's focus on energy-efficient AI computing addresses sustainability concerns in data centers, appealing to environmentally conscious investors.
Competitive Position in Semiconductors
NVIDIA holds over 80% market share in AI GPUs, far ahead of competitors like AMD and Intel. Custom ASICs from hyperscalers pose a long-term threat, but NVIDIA's software ecosystem and rapid iteration cycles maintain leadership.
Partnerships with TSMC for advanced nodes ensure supply chain resilience. Geopolitical tensions in chip manufacturing highlight NVIDIA's U.S.-based design advantage, though fabrication relies on Taiwan.
In comparison to software-focused AI plays like Palantir, NVIDIA's hardware dominance provides durable economics at the AI stack's base. This positioning captures value across the entire AI value chain.

Risks and Key Watchpoints
Market concentration in a few hyperscalers exposes NVIDIA to customer spending shifts. AI hype cycles could lead to volatility if growth moderates. Regulatory scrutiny on AI and antitrust in semiconductors warrants monitoring.
Supply chain disruptions, particularly from Taiwan, remain a concern amid geopolitical risks. Competition intensifies as rivals scale production. Investors should track quarterly Data Center growth and margin trends.
Next catalysts include FY2027 guidance, Blackwell ramp-up, and new platform announcements. Watch for enterprise AI adoption metrics and free cash flow deployment. North American investors should monitor U.S. export controls on AI tech.
Valuation stretches if AI demand plateaus, though current multiples reflect growth trajectory. Balanced portfolios consider these factors alongside broader market conditions.
